DRUNK DRIVING CHARGE TO BE DISMISS: CARELESS DRIVING OFFERED TO NLF CLIENT AFTER RELENTLESS LITIGATION

An NLF client was allowed to accept a plea to careless driving in exchange for the dismissal of a drunk driving charge. "We worked our butts off because it was the right thing to do," said attorney Mike Nichols. The NLF client was indigent. The results of his datamaster test were .09 .11 .09. "Those results were too disparate to ignore. I am proud because we found a defense for this young man when he was ready to plead guilty," Nichols added. the case was a roller coaster ride, with the court denying a motion for payment of an expert witness at court expense and the circuit court affirming after an interlocutory appeal. Nichols said: "sometimes all you have is fortitude going for you ... and sometimes that's enough."
